          TRPC5 Antibody (MA5-27657) in IHC (P)

          Immunohistochemistry analysis of TRPC5 in mouse brain. Samples were incubated with TRPC5 monoclonal antibody (Product # MA5-27657) using a dilution of 1:1000 (1 hour at RT) and followed by Biotinylated Goat Anti-Mouse, Streptavidin Peroxidase, DAB Chromogen (brown) and Mayer Hematoxylin (purple/blue) at a dilution of 250-500 µl.           Product Specific Information

          Formerly sold as clone (S67/15).

          1 µg/mL of MA5-27657 was sufficient for detection of TrpC5 in 20 µg of rat brain lysate by colorimetric immunoblot analysis using Goat anti-mouse IgG:HRP as the secondary antibody.|Detects approximately 110kDa.

          Target Information

          TRPC5 belongs to the transient receptor family. TRPC5 is one of the seven mammalian TRPC (transient receptor potential channel) proteins. The TRPC5 protein is a multi-pass membrane protein and is thought to form a receptor-activated non-selective calcium permeant cation channel. TRPC5 is active alone or as a heteromultimeric assembly with TRPC1, TRPC3, and TRPC4. TRPC5 also interacts with multiple proteins including calmodulin, CABP1, enkurin, Na(+)-H+ exchange regulatory factor (NHERF ), interferon-induced GTP-binding protein (MX1), ring finger protein 24 (RNF24), and SEC14 domain and spectrin repeat-containing protein 1 (SESTD1). TRPC5 is thought to form a receptor-activated non-selective calcium permeant cation channel. TRPC5 is probably operated by a phosphatidylinositol second messenger system activated by receptor tyrosine kinases, or G-protein coupled receptors. TRPC5 has also been shown to be calcium-selective, and may also be activated by intracellular calcium store depletion. Diseases associated with TRPC5 include Hypertrophic Pyloric Stenosis and Pyloric Stenosis.
